" An ideal opportunity for the FIRST TIME BUYER to acquire this deceptively spacious TWO DOUBLE BEDROOM mid terraced house, offered for sale with NO UPWARD CHAIN involved and benefitting from a garden to the rear with OPEN ASPECT. With UPVC double glazing and gas central heating throughout. EPC rating C71.

DETAILS An ideal opportunity for the first time buyer to acquire this deceptively spacious two double bedroom mid terraced house, offered for sale with no upward chain involved and benefitting from a garden to the rear with open aspect.

With UPVC double glazing and gas central heating throughout, the accommodation briefly comprises; living room, spacious kitchen/diner, cellar, first floor landing, two double bedrooms and the modern house bathroom/w.c. Outside, there is a buffer garden to the front, whilst to the rear, a paved and lawned garden with open aspect.

The property is conveniently placed for access to a range of amenities including local shops, schools and bus routes travelling between Wakefield and Leeds. For those wishing to commute further afield there is also easy access to Outwood Train Station, the M1 and M62 motorway networks.
